Jonathan Pledges To Establish Airports In 36 States by LagosBoy1: 10:18am On Mar 18, 2011
March 18, 2011 01:31AM

President Goodluck Jonathan in Dutse on Thursday promised to ensure that all the 36 states have a domestic airport, if he is elected in April.

Mr. Jonathan, who is the PDP presidential candidate, made the promise while inaugurating 500 housing units built by Governor Sule Lamido's administration.

"If I win the election, within my four years in office, I will establish domestic airports in all the states without airports.

"We will work with the state governments to achieve that and Jigawa will be our focal point," Mr Jonathan said.

He said the airports would boost economic activities in the country.

The President commended Mr. Lamido for the development projects executed within four years, saying that the quality of those projects were of PDP standard.

In his remarks, Mr. Lamido said the housing estate was named after the former governor of defunct Kano State, Abubakar Rimi, to immortalise him for his selfless service during his administration before Jigawa was carved out of Kano.

There is an airport in Akure, less than 40 miles away from Ado-Ekiti.

If we built an airport in Ekiti, it cannibalizes business away from the one in Akure and makes both airports sickly and weak.

If there were an excellent road from Akure to Ado-Ekiti, you can make that drive in under 1 hour.

That to me seems a way better use of resources than building an airport.
